ARCHITECT‘S SPECIFICATION
A wireless RF transmission system designed for presen-
tation use and other applications where maximum speech
intelligibility is required.
The system shall consist of a stationary receiver, a bo-
dypack transmitter and a condenser headset microphone.
Operating in the license-free 1.9 GHz band (frequency ran-
ges are between 1,880 and 1,930 MHz, depending on coun-
try-specific regulations), the system shall use automatic
frequency management to determine the best free avai-
lable frequency and to automatically start the transmis-
sion. Additionally, the system shall incorporate automatic
interference management, allowing the transmitter and
receiver to move to an undisturbed, compatible frequen-
cy with no audio signal interruption, should interference
occur. Furthermore, advanced 256-bit AES encryption shall
be used for secure wireless transmission.
The systems AF frequency response shall range from 20 –
20,000 Hz. The dynamic range shall be > 120 dB(A). Total
harmonic distortion (THD) at 1 kHz shall be typical 0.1 %.
Signal-to-noise ratio shall be > 90 dB(A). Latency shall be
19 ms. Operating temperature shall range from -10 °C to
+55 °C (+14 °F to +131 °F).
The user interface of the receiver shall be operated by jog
dial and OLED display. The receiver shall have dedicated
pairing, escape and power buttons.
The receiver shall feature a low-cut filter as well as spe-
ech-optimized sound profiles or custom settings with a
7-band graphic equalizer. The receivers RF sensitivity shall
be -90 dBm. RF output power of the receiver’s back chan-
nel shall be adaptive and up to 250 mW (country-specific).
The receiver’s audio output shall utilize a balanced XLR-
3M socket with a maximum output of +18 dBu along with
two unbalanced RCA sockets with a maximum output of
+6 dBu. The receiver shall feature automatic gain opti-
mization. Two reverse SMA sockets shall be provided for
connecting the antennas.
The receiver shall feature RJ-45 network connectivity com-
patible with IPv4 and IPv6 networks. For remote control the
receiver shall have media control protocol integration.
The receiver shall operate on 12 V DC power supplied from
the NT 12-4C power supply unit (100-240 V AC, 50/60 Hz,
for use in the USA, the UK, and Europe) or the NT 2-3
power supply unit (100-240 V AC, 50/60 Hz, for use in
countries other than the USA, the UK, and Europe). Power
consumption shall be 350 mA. The dimensions shall be
approximately 168 x 212 x 43 mm (6.61" x 8.35" x 1.69").
Weight shall be approximately 828 grams (1.83 lbs). The
receiver shall be the Sennheiser SL Rack Receiver DW.
The transmitter shall be powered by either one Sennheiser
Lithium-Ion rechargeable accupack with a typical opera-
ting time of 15 hours or with an optional battery case for
two 1.5 V AA size batteries. The accupack can be quick-
ly charged through a wide variety of charging options,
including micro USB. The accupack shall have charging
contacts on the outside for charging in the dedicated
CHG 2 charger.
The bodypack transmitter’s microphone/line input shall
utilize a lockable 3.5 mm jack socket. The AF frequency
response shall range from 50 – 20,000 Hz (mic) and from
20 – 20,000 Hz (line). RF output power shall be adapti-
ve and up to 250 mW (country-specific). The maximum
input level shall be 2.2 Vrms (mic) or 3.3 Vrms (line). Input
impedance shall be 1 MΩ (line). The bodypack transmitter
shall have automatic sensitivity adjustment. Dimensions
shall be approximately 100 x 65 x 24 mm (3.94" x 2.56" x
0.94"). Weight (without accupack) shall be approximately
88 grams (3.10 oz). The bodypack transmitter shall feature
an LC display showing wireless link name, battery status,
and reception quality. The bodypack transmitter shall be
the Sennheiser SL Bodypack DW.
The microphone suitable for use with the bodypack trans-
mitter shall be a condenser type with an omni-directional
pick-up pattern and a sensitivity of 5 mV/Pa. Maximum
sound pressure level shall be 142 dB SPL. The headset
microphone shall be the Sennheiser SL Headmic 1.
All devices can be monitored and controlled with the
Sennheiser Control Cockpit.
The wireless RF transmission system shall be the
Sennheiser SpeechLine Digital Wireless SL Headmic Set.
